Split type construction guardrail
Technical Field
The invention belongs to the technical field of building construction, and particularly relates to a split type construction guardrail.
Background
Along with the continuous development of society, the style of building is also changing constantly, but when the building construction, it is indispensable protective equipment still to face the limit department and set up the guardrail, and it can strengthen the safety guarantee when using, avoids appearing the incident, and this type of guardrail for the building construction on the market is various now, can satisfy people's user demand basically, but still has certain problem:
1. most of the existing guardrails for building construction are generally fixedly connected with each other by screws or bolts during assembly, so that a large amount of labor and time are consumed during installation and disassembly;
2. the existing guardrail for building construction is used for building adjacent edges or dangerous areas, but has only a protection function and has no warning function.
Disclosure of Invention
The invention solves the defects of the prior art and provides the split construction guardrail which is convenient to install and disassemble and has the warning function.

As shown in fig. 1 to 4, the invention provides a split type construction guardrail, which comprises a plurality of guardrail units, wherein each guardrail unit comprises a frame body 1, support legs 2 and protection plates 3, the support legs 2 are fixedly connected to two sides of the bottom end of the frame body 1, a protection opening 5 is formed in the middle of the frame body 1 in a surrounding manner, a plurality of protection plates 3 are arranged inside the protection opening 5, the frame body 1 and the protection plates 3 and adjacent protection plates 3 are mutually connected and fixed through a plurality of buffer structures 4,
the buffer structure 4 comprises a sliding chute 401, inclined rods 402, a fixing plate 403, a protection spring 404 and a sliding block 405, wherein the sliding chute 401 is arranged on one side of the protection plate 3, the fixing plate 403 is fixed on the protection plate 3 or the frame body 1 adjacent to the protection plate 3 or the frame body 1 at a position opposite to the sliding chute 401, two sliding blocks 405 are symmetrically and slidably connected in the sliding chute 401 by taking the center of the sliding chute as a symmetry axis, the sliding blocks 405 are hinged with one end of each inclined rod 402, the other ends of the two inclined rods 402 are hinged on the fixing plate 403 through the same rotating shaft, and the fixing plate 403 is connected with the bottom surface of the sliding chute 401 through the protection spring 404;
when the mechanism is used, when the frame body 1 is vibrated, the buffer structure 4 separates the frame body 1 from the protection plate 3 and the adjacent protection plate, so that the frame body 1 is prevented from colliding with each other to generate abrasion in use;
the adjacent guardrail units are connected through a quick dismounting mechanism, the quick dismounting mechanism comprises a lock tongue mechanism arranged on one side of the frame body 1 and a clamping rod mechanism arranged on the other side of the frame body 1 and matched with the lock tongue mechanism for use, the lock tongue mechanism comprises a lock box 6 and a pull ring 7, the top of the lock box 6 is provided with an opening and an internal cavity, one side of the lock box 6 is fixed on the frame body 1, the other side of the lock box 6 is provided with a through hole 16, one side of the pull ring 7 is arranged on the outer side of the lock box 6 to form a control end, the other side of the pull ring 7 is arranged in the lock box 6 to form an action end, the middle of the pull ring 7 is slidably arranged in the through hole 16, an anti-skid second protective pad 15 is fixed on the inner side of the control end of the pull ring 7, a return spring 17 is fixed on one side facing the control end of the pull ring 7, the other end of the return spring 17 is fixed on the inner wall of the lock box 6, and a clamping sheet 18 is fixed on the other side of the action end of the pull ring; the clamping rod mechanism comprises a clamping rod 9 fixed on the frame body 1, and a slot 10 matched with the clamping sheet 18 in size is arranged on the clamping rod 9; the outer diameter of the clamping rod 9 is smaller than the size of the inner cavity of the lock box 6, when the guardrail locking device is used, the clamping rod 9 on one guardrail unit is inserted into the lock box 6 of the other guardrail unit from top to bottom, the pull ring 7 is pulled outwards at the same time, the clamping sheet 18 is driven to move, the clamping rod 9 is inserted into the bottom of the lock box 6, the slot 10 in the clamping rod 9 is just positioned at the position of the clamping sheet 18, at the moment, the pull ring 7 is loosened, the return spring 7 drives the clamping sheet 18 to return, the clamping sheet 18 is inserted into the slot 10, the clamping rod 9 is locked, and when the guardrail locking device is disassembled and assembled, the reverse operation is carried out;
the top end of the frame body 1 is fixedly connected with a warning structure 8, the warning structure 8 comprises a handle 801, a cross rod 802, a fluorescent plate 803, a window 804 and side rods 805, the bottom ends of the two side rods 805 are fixedly connected with the top end of the frame body 1, the cross rod 802 is fixedly connected between the two side rods 805, a cavity is arranged in the middle of the cross rod 802, an accommodating opening matched with the cavity in size is formed in the top of the cross rod 802, windows communicated with the cavity are arranged on the front side and the rear side of the cross rod, the fluorescent plate 803 matched with the cavity in size is inserted in the cross rod 802, and the handle 801 is fixedly connected with the top end of the fluorescent plate 803; when the cross bar 802 is used, light is reflected at night through the fluorescent plate 803 to warn the cross bar, so that a pedestrian is prevented from running by mistake.
The stabilizer blade 2 includes that bracing piece 13 and U type support, the U type supports the horizon bar that includes two vertical poles and connects two vertical poles, the tip of two vertical poles of U type support towards ground, and be fixed with the first protection pad 12 with ground contact on it, the middle part that the horizon bar was supported to the U type is fixed with bracing piece 13, be fixed with connecting plate 14 on the bracing piece 13, the U type supports and passes through connecting plate 14 and frame 1 and pass through the bolt and can dismantle the connection, be fixed with the swash plate 11 of strengthening support intensity between the vertical pole that the U type supported and the horizon bar.
The working principle is as follows: when the guardrail for building construction is used, firstly, the frame body 1 is placed at a specified position, the adjacent guardrail units are mutually clamped and connected by utilizing the clamping rod 9 and the lock box 6, when the guardrail is disassembled, the clamping sheet 18 can be separated from the slot 10 by pulling the pull ring 7, and at the moment, the guardrail can be disassembled; secondly, the protection plates 3 are separated by the fixing plate 403 when the protective plate is used, so that the phenomenon that the protection plates 3 are worn when the protective plate is used is avoided, and meanwhile, the protection spring 404 can elastically buffer the protection plates; and finally, the fluorescent plate 803 is placed inside the cross rod 802, so that the cross rod 802 can reflect light at night when the guardrail is used, the light is warned, the pedestrian is prevented from running by mistake, and the work of the guardrail for building construction is finally completed.
